A9VG电玩部落论坛

 找回密码
 注册
搜索
查看: 3794|回复: 24

(分享)32G树莓派3B最新RETROPIE4.7.1整合镜像

[复制链接]

精华
0
帖子
135
威望
0 点
积分
136 点
种子
12 点
注册时间
2017-8-28
最后登录
2022-11-20
 楼主| 发表于 2021-7-7 23:53  ·  内蒙古 | 显示全部楼层 |阅读模式
本帖最后由 赚钱买玩具 于 2021-7-8 00:04 编辑

树莓派3B游戏机镜像自从A大、W大分享过真百炼成钢后很久没有更新了。出于好奇,本人利用下班时间花了一个月的时间使用最新版复古派系统自己整合了一个镜像,镜像大小29.7GB,其中ROM基本来自于真百炼成钢镜像,甚至连ROM名都没改,依然是“淘宝奸商勿用*”,另外收集了一些其他论坛分享的汉化ROM和HACK游戏。本人不懂编程,无法像W大、G大那样自己编译模拟核心,只是参考网上的教程自己摸索着做,所以本镜像没有什么值得称道的独创的东西,系统基本上就是原原本本的retropie4.7.1。

本镜像整合后共17个机种,约1698款游戏,受卡容量限制,为了多加游戏,删除了原真百炼成钢镜像中的绝大多数游戏预览视频,同时也删除了需要鼠标或键盘操作的部分机种。其中arcade类全部都是PGM的游戏,街机游戏我收集的都是热门游戏,带隐藏角色的大多数游戏打了可选隐藏角色补丁,HACK游戏不多,但是都是比较耐玩的,也尽量备注了修改者ID;MD、NES、GBA等几个机种增加了部分网上比较推荐的经典游戏;openbor游戏保留了经过测试能够正常运行的版本,添加了最新的怒之铁拳重制版5.2。镜像中的游戏未一一进行测试,也不完全保证没有重复,如果遇到无法运行的,请更换模拟核心试试,个人感觉99%应该都可以正常运行。

折腾这玩意确实费时费力,美化、挑选ROM、打补丁、写列表、收集覆层,每一项都很耗时间,而且永远称不上完美,以本人的能力,没有必要再继续折腾下去了,目前尚留有遗憾四处,未找到解决方案:一是ES前端在频繁切换游戏一定次数之后必定崩溃,不清楚是汉化的锅还是这系统就这样;二是本人尝试了很多方法仍然无法让port游戏像其他机种一样自定义游戏列表和预览图;三是openbor游戏中的nightslasherX,不清楚是机能限制还是引擎问题,玩一段时间后必定强退,尤其是格挡技能频繁触发时更容易退出,可惜了这款好游戏,亏我还在OPENBOR游戏群里学了一些皮毛对这个游戏进行了简单的改动。四是FBA机种中有一款叫“光明使者 美版 汉化版”的,使用FBN模拟核心运行居然会卡,没办法同时放了一个使用MAME运行的美版原版。以上问题,如果有大神可以解决,可以的话,麻烦提供下解决方案,先谢谢了。

本镜像适用于树莓派3B,可能也适用于所有树莓派2和树莓派3系。同时发布于A9VG和PPX论坛,仅供学习交流使用,请勿用于商业用途。侵删。

链接:https://pan.baidu.com/s/1uHb_wANXC7jkEKYnGMcmIQ
提取码:1024   
失效不补

精华
0
帖子
98
威望
0 点
积分
367 点
种子
335 点
注册时间
2004-3-24
最后登录
2022-2-28
发表于 2021-7-8 12:52  ·  辽宁 | 显示全部楼层
感谢,很有用,感谢整合

精华
0
帖子
2656
威望
0 点
积分
5017 点
种子
1583 点
注册时间
2005-4-26
最后登录
2024-12-21
发表于 2021-7-11 13:11  ·  上海 | 显示全部楼层
支持折腾,我也是花在折腾上的时间比玩游戏的时间多,有了百炼成钢之后就好多了

精华
0
帖子
230
威望
0 点
积分
231 点
种子
13 点
注册时间
2016-8-10
最后登录
2024-12-18
发表于 2021-7-11 22:53  ·  黑龙江 | 显示全部楼层
es崩溃是因为游戏列表用了中文,这里有一个内存泄漏的bug,所以在浏览了足够数量的中文名后就会崩溃,我已经被此问题困扰了3年了,无奈不会编程,解决不了。

精华
0
帖子
135
威望
0 点
积分
136 点
种子
12 点
注册时间
2017-8-28
最后登录
2022-11-20
 楼主| 发表于 2021-7-12 23:01  ·  内蒙古 | 显示全部楼层
送雨 发表于 2021-7-11 22:53
es崩溃是因为游戏列表用了中文,这里有一个内存泄漏的bug,所以在浏览了足够数量的中文名后就会崩溃,我已 ...

大神,你都解决不了,说明确实棘手。OPENBOR的游戏列表我还是没解决,哈哈

精华
0
帖子
253
威望
0 点
积分
280 点
种子
33 点
注册时间
2015-4-18
最后登录
2024-12-14
发表于 2021-7-13 02:32  ·  广东 | 显示全部楼层
感谢楼主的分享。多谢了

精华
0
帖子
135
威望
0 点
积分
136 点
种子
12 点
注册时间
2017-8-28
最后登录
2022-11-20
 楼主| 发表于 2021-7-15 20:42  ·  内蒙古 | 显示全部楼层
送雨 发表于 2021-7-11 22:53
es崩溃是因为游戏列表用了中文,这里有一个内存泄漏的bug,所以在浏览了足够数量的中文名后就会崩溃,我已 ...

大神有没有试过batocera系统,这系统存不存在这个问题。

精华
0
帖子
230
威望
0 点
积分
231 点
种子
13 点
注册时间
2016-8-10
最后登录
2024-12-18
发表于 2021-7-17 03:02  ·  黑龙江 | 显示全部楼层
赚钱买玩具 发表于 2021-7-15 20:42
大神有没有试过batocera系统,这系统存不存在这个问题。

非常不幸的是,bato也有这个问题,有国外网友提出这个问题了,不过咱们自己用中文的都没人去解决这个,他们也就聊聊就算了,有关的信息你可以看这里:
https://github.com/batocera-linu ... nstation/issues/213
主要是因为这些系统用的es一开始都是分叉于retropie的es的,所以这个问题可以说是很早一些的时期就存在了,我其实想试试emuelec的es,那个也是分叉于retropie的,但是后来改动的实在太大,没准就没有这个错误了呢。不过由于改的太离谱了,把retropie里面的es和runcommand的功能用一个前端就实现了,所以我一直没有试,你要感兴趣,可以试着编译一下这个es,看看在树莓派上能不能跑,不过由于结构变了,要改动很多才能运行。源码位置就是这个:
https://github.com/EmuELEC/emuelec-emulationstation

这个问题我想会编程的人应该比较容易解决,可惜没人关注这个,我这里有个方法可以暂时解决掉这个问题,可惜只能测试的时候防止跳出,不能真的来用,那就是改分辨率,输出分辨率为720的时候,这个问题就没有了,或者说把延迟泄露的长度变成了一个你几乎碰不到数值了,比如翻几万条才会跳出。你感兴趣的话研究一下吧,有什么好的方法也告诉我一下,我等官方解决都等了3年了,我估计是没什么希望了。

精华
0
帖子
135
威望
0 点
积分
136 点
种子
12 点
注册时间
2017-8-28
最后登录
2022-11-20
 楼主| 发表于 2021-7-18 02:49  ·  内蒙古 | 显示全部楼层
送雨 发表于 2021-7-17 03:02
非常不幸的是,bato也有这个问题,有国外网友提出这个问题了,不过咱们自己用中文的都没人去解决这个,他 ...

哈哈,高估我了。编译什么的完全没基础。解决不了就不强求了,毕竟树莓派3也快被淘汰了,想玩emuelec直接考虑换硬件好了。

精华
0
帖子
103
威望
0 点
积分
103 点
种子
18 点
注册时间
2006-9-26
最后登录
2024-12-21
发表于 2021-7-21 15:16  ·  广东 | 显示全部楼层
要是ES有汉化就好了~
您需要登录后才可以回帖 登录 | 注册

本版积分规则

Archiver|手机版|A9VG电玩部落 川公网安备 51019002005286号

GMT+8, 2024-12-22 10:58 , Processed in 0.240306 second(s), 15 queries , Redis On.

Powered by Discuz! X3.4

Copyright © 2001-2020, Tencent Cloud.

返回顶部